"The nose is pleasant and powerful with aromas of red fruits and candy, followed by lactic and buttery notes. On the palate, it is vinous with a strong structure, suppleness, and a perfect balance. Fragrant with white and pink flowers, yellow apple, lemon, and a kiss of caramel oxidation. Melted butter and creamy, fine mousse on a body of creamy red apple flesh. 50% Chardonnay and 50% Meunier, all from the first press. No dosage, made without added sulphites, with no enzymes, tannin, coal, or chaptalisation."
— Official Producer Notes
